Overview: Train from Walkden to Chester
Typically, there are 3 trains per day from Walkden to Chester, including direct trains, taking around 1h 21m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£15 if you book in advance.
The earliest train runs at 03:51, the last at 22:27. The fastest train covers the 49 km distance in 1h 19m.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Walkden: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: No, Step free access note: Category C Station, Services towards Manchester: From Walkden Road, up 14 steps into the ticket office and then up 28 steps onto the platform. Trains to Manchester leave on the left. Services Towards Wigan leave on the right,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Ramp for train access: No,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Chester: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Category A. Step free access is available to all platforms via lifts,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
